Which trio of vitamins is credited with supporting the synthesis of collagen, a protein vital for maintaining skin firmness, when consuming Gac fruit?
Answer
Vitamins A, E, and C
Gac fruit contributes positively to skin health and the slowing of physical aging partly through its supportive role in producing collagen. Collagen is a fundamental protein essential for maintaining skin structure, firmness, and elasticity. The text specifies that the presence of Vitamins A, E, and C within the fruit assists the body in synthesizing this crucial protein. Furthermore, the fruit's low sugar content is also noted as a contributing factor to reduced skin aging and decreased acne incidence, creating a multifaceted approach to dermal wellness supported by these essential fat-soluble and water-soluble vitamins.
